Glamping in Antelope puts you right at the edge of Oregon’s rugged high desert, with over a dozen options that skip tents in favor of plush beds, hot showers, and wifi. Expect prices averaging $140 a night, but you can snag a spot for as little as $35. You'll find campfires allowed at most sites—perfect after a day spent hiking, swimming, or riding horses across open range. For a mix of comfort and wild surroundings, check out Justesen Ranches (92 reviews), Big Rock Ranch (85 reviews), or Antelope Market and RV Park Camping (44 reviews). These spots all nail the basics: hot showers, reliable wifi, and room to unwind under wide-open skies.

Antelope Basecamp

1. Antelope Basecamp

99%
(154)
0.1mi from Antelope · 8 sites
We are located in the heart of Antelope, a rural (near) Ghost town that is rich in history and culture. This particular property is currently being cleaned up and revitalized. We would like to open it up to dry camping, some cabins, and RV Spaces with partial hookups at this time as we are already seeing a huge influx of cyclists and motorcycles in the area and they have no place to camp. There is a bathhouse onsite as part of the Pavilion structure. Please do not park on grass, unless you are an RV Space with partial hookups that has made arrangements with park host. Thank you for visiting and having patience while we continue to fix up the property.

Justesen Ranches

2. Justesen Ranches

96%
(195)
31mi from Antelope · 23 sites · Tents, RVs, Lodging
Justesen Ranches is family owned working cattle, wheat and recreation ranch. Our properties are located in the Columbia River Plateau in North Central Oregon. Enjoy wide open spaces, reservoirs for wildlife watching and clear night skies for star gazing. This is a leave no trace, pack it in, pack it out camping area. The property is located in Tygh Valley and is only a few minutes from the general store and the stunning White River Falls State Park. The Deschutes River whitewater rafting hub of Maupin is just a 10 minute drive away. The lodge two hours from Portland and 30 min from The Dalles.

Kah Nee Ta High Desert RV Park

10. Kah Nee Ta High Desert RV Park

29mi from Antelope · 213 sites
Kah-Nee-Ta Hot Springs is a unique destination that offers a harmonious blend of natural beauty, cultural heritage, and rejuvenating experiences. For generations, Oregonians and visitors alike have cherished the breathtaking high-desert landscapes, invigorating hot springs, and rich Native American culture that define this remarkable location. As the first destination resort east of the Cascades, Kah-Nee-Ta has long been a beloved retreat, though it faced challenges that led to its closure in 2018. However, a dedicated community of supporters has come together to revitalize this cherished site, securing the necessary funding and innovative leadership to bring Kah-Nee-Ta back to life. At Kah-Nee-Ta Hot Springs, we invite you to relax, recharge, and embrace the healing powers of nature. Our tranquil environment allows you to escape the stresses of everyday life, while the soothing waters work their magic to help you become the best version of yourself. With a variety of outdoor activities, nearby swimming holes, and stunning natural features, there’s no shortage of adventures to embark on during your stay. Additionally, you’ll find local restaurants and shops that showcase the vibrant culture of the Warm Springs community, making your visit not only refreshing but also enriching.
